  • The Anne Laukaitis Champion for Children Award is in honor of Anne’s distinguished Smart Start leadership and her long career dedicated to the service of young children and families in Cabarrus County. This award is given annually to an exceptional individual at the local level who is devoted to public service and whose leadership qualities have resulted in significant change for the improvement of young children, families, and communities. Among the leadership qualities the recipient will exemplify are:

    • Passionate commitment to the vision of a stronger community for children and families.
    • The ability to lead and inspire others in pursuit of that vision.
    • Personal integrity, humility, and professional will.
    • Willingness to work hard, stay the course even in the face of adversity, and acknowledge the contributions of others.
    • An unbridled and optimistic pursuit of possibility.

    The 16th Annual Anne Laukaitis Champion for Children Award will be given at the 2025 Annual Meeting/Voices for Children Luncheon of the Cabarrus County Partnership for Children (CCPC) Board of Directors on Tuesday, December 2, 2025, at McGill Baptist Church Sanctuary at noon. The recipient will be honored and will receive a plaque of thanks at the meeting. The family of the recipient will be invited to the Annual Meeting/Voice for Children Luncheon to share in the award presentation.
